Purpose
This assessment is designed for freshers with 0–1 year of experience, aiming to evaluate their foundational understanding of E-commerce management within the logistics, transport, and supply chain industry.
Overview
The assessment consists of questions that cover essential aspects of E-commerce management, tailored for entry-level candidates in the logistics, transport, and supply chain industry. It evaluates core traits such as analytical thinking, understanding of digital marketing strategies, and customer-centric approaches. The test is structured to assess foundational skills in E-commerce, including competitor analysis, user experience optimization, and effective use of digital tools. Candidates are expected to demonstrate their ability to understand and apply basic E-commerce concepts, ensuring they are prepared for roles that require managing online sales platforms and enhancing customer engagement.
